Abstract
A playpen includes a frame member and a fabric enclosure member. The frame member includes a top frame unit and a plurality of leg units that are connected to the top frame unit. Each of the leg units includes a plurality of first fasteners that are spacedly arranged along a longitudinal direction thereof. The fabric enclosure member includes a plurality of second fasteners for engaging respectively the first fasteners for securing the fabric enclosure member to the frame member. The fabric enclosure member cooperates with the leg units and the top frame unit of the frame member to define an inner play space.

- 1. Field of the Invention
- The present invention relates to a playpen, more particularly to a playpen including a frame member and a fabric enclosure member.
- 2. Description of the Related Art
- Referring to
FIGS. 1 and 2 , a conventional rectangular playpen includes aframe member 8 and afabric enclosure member 9 that can be secured to theframe member 8. Theframe member 8 and thefabric enclosure member 9 can be assembled to define an inner play space within which infants and young children can perform activities. - The
frame member 8 includes fourleg units 81 disposed at the four corners, respectively, and thefabric enclosure member 9 is disposed to enclose an outer periphery defined by theleg units 81. Thefabric enclosure member 9 is secured to theleg units 81 in a stretched state by a plurality ofscrews 82, each of which extends through awasher 83, thefabric enclosure member 9, and a lower portion of a respective one of theleg units 81 in the order given. - However, securing the
fabric enclosure member 9 to theleg units 81 with the use of thescrews 82 generally requires a longer assembly time, and damages thefabric enclosure member 9 such that thefabric enclosure member 9 is susceptible to tearing at parts where thescrews 82 pass. In addition, the playpen is aesthetically compromised by thescrews 82. - Referring to
FIG. 3 , U.S. Pat. No. 4,811,437 discloses a playpen including acollapsible frame member 10, and afabric enclosure member 15 adapted to enclose theframe member 10 so as to define an inner play space within which infants and young children can perform activities. Theframe member 10 includes a plurality ofcorner pieces 11, a plurality ofelongated hand rails 12 pivoted to thecorner pieces 11, a plurality offoot pieces 13, and a plurality ofleg units 14 connected to thecorner pieces 11. In the assembly process of the playpen, theleg units 14 must be extended through thefabric enclosure member 15 for coupling between thecorner pieces 11 and thefoot pieces 13. However, theleg units 14 are free to move about relative to thefabric enclosure member 15, which may hinder the assembly process. - Therefore, an object of the present invention is to provide a playpen including a frame member and a fabric enclosure member that can overcome at least one of the above drawbacks of the prior art.
- According to the present invention, a playpen includes a frame member and a fabric enclosure member. The frame member includes a top frame unit and a plurality of leg units that are connected to the top frame unit. Each of the leg units includes a plurality of first fasteners that are spacedly arranged along a longitudinal direction thereof. The fabric enclosure member includes a plurality of second fasteners for engaging respectively the first fasteners for securing the fabric enclosure member to the frame member. The fabric enclosure member cooperates with the leg units and the top frame unit of the frame member to define an inner play space.
- Another object of the present invention is to provide a frame member adapted for use with a fabric enclosure member that includes a plurality of fastener parts. Accordingly, a frame member of the present invention includes a top frame unit and a plurality of leg units connected to the top frame unit. Each of the leg units includes a plurality of fastener pieces that are spacedly arranged along a longitudinal direction thereof, and that are adapted for engaging respectively the fastener parts of the fabric enclosure member for securing the fabric enclosure member to the frame member in a manner that the fabric enclosure member cooperates with the leg units and the top frame unit of the frame member to define an inner play space.
- Yet another object of the present invention is to provide a fabric enclosure member adapted to be secured to a frame member that includes a top frame unit and a plurality of leg units connected to the top frame unit. Each of the leg units includes a plurality of fastener pieces that are spacedly arranged along a longitudinal direction thereof. Accordingly, a fabric enclosure member of the present invention includes a fabric enclosure body provided with a plurality of fastener parts that are adapted for engaging respectively the fastener pieces of the leg units for securing the fabric enclosure member to the frame member in a manner that the fabric enclosure member cooperates with the leg units and the top frame unit of the frame member to define an inner play space.
- Through engaging the first fasteners of the frame member with the second fasteners of the fabric enclosure member, the fabric enclosure member can be assembled to the frame member without the use of screws, thereby shortening the assembly time and improving the durability of the playpen.

- Referring to
FIGS. 4 and 5 , the first preferred embodiment of aplaypen 2 according to the present invention includes aframe member 21 and afabric enclosure member 22 assembled to theframe member 21. Theframe member 21 is a rectangular frame member, and includes atop frame unit 211, abottom frame unit 212, and a plurality ofcurved leg units 213 connected to and disposed at four corners of thetop frame unit 211 and thebottom frame unit 212. - The
top frame unit 211 includes a plurality ofcorner pieces 211 a and a plurality ofelongated hand rails 211 b connected to thecorner pieces 211 a. Each of theleg units 213 is connected to a corresponding one of thecorner pieces 211 a. Each of theleg units 213 includes a plurality of first fasteners (or fastener pieces) 215 that are spacedly arranged along a longitudinal direction thereof. Thefabric enclosure member 22 has afabric enclosure body 220 with a plurality ofelongated flap portions 222 that are respectively adjacent to theleg units 213, and a plurality ofsleeve portions 221 for extension of thehand rails 211 b of thetop frame unit 211 therethrough, respectively. Thefabric enclosure member 22 further includes a plurality of second fasteners (or fastener parts) 223 that are disposed on theelongated flap portions 222 along a longitudinal direction of the same, that are disposed to correspond respectively to thefirst fasteners 215, and that are for engaging respectively thefirst fasteners 215 of an adjacent one of theleg units 213 so as to secure thefabric enclosure member 22 to theframe member 21. Each of thesleeve portions 221 is formed by folding a top portion of thefabric enclosure member 22 toward the bottom of thefabric enclosure member 22, and sewing the folded portion to thefabric enclosure member 22 along a transverse direction between two adjacent ones of theleg units 213. - The
fabric enclosure member 22 is secured to theleg units 213 and thehand rails 211 b of thetop frame unit 211 to define aninner play space 3 within which infants and young children can perform activities. Thefirst fasteners 215 are disposed to face toward theinner play space 3. - The
bottom frame unit 212 includes a plurality offoot pieces 212 a and a plurality ofbase rods 212 b pivoted to thefoot pieces 212 a. Each of thefoot pieces 212 a is connected to a corresponding one of theleg units 213. - Referring to
FIG. 5 , in the present embodiment, thefirst fasteners 215 are riveted to theleg units 213. Each of thefirst fasteners 215 is a male snap fastener formed with aprotrusion 215 a, and each of thesecond fasteners 223 is a female snap fastener formed with arecess 223 a for engaging releasably theprotrusion 215 a of a corresponding one of thefirst fasteners 215. However, arrangement of the first and 215, 223 is not limited to such. That is to say, in another embodiment of the present invention, each of thesecond fasteners first fasteners 215 can be a female snap fastener formed with a recess, and each of thesecond fasteners 223 can be a male snap fastener formed with a protrusion for engaging releasably the recess in a corresponding one of thefirst fasteners 215. - Assembling the
fabric enclosure member 22 to theframe member 21 includes the steps of: - Step 1) disposing the
fabric enclosure member 22 on thebase rods 212 b; - Step 2) sleeving each of the
sleeve portions 221 on a corresponding one of thehand rails 211 b; and - Step 3) engaging the
second fasteners 223 on theelongated flap portions 222 to thefirst fasteners 215 of theleg units 213. - Referring to
FIGS. 6 and 7 , in the second preferred embodiment of aplaypen 2 according to the present invention, each of theleg units 213 includes a plurality of first fasteners (or fastener pieces) 219, each of which is formed with aninsert slot 219 a. Thefabric enclosure member 22 includes a plurality of second fasteners (or fastener parts) 224, each of which is formed with an inverted L-shapedhook 224 a for engaging theinsert slot 219 a of a corresponding one of thefirst fasteners 219. Similar to the first preferred embodiment, arrangement of the first and 219, 224 in the second preferred embodiment is not limited to such. That is to say, in another embodiment of the present invention, each of thesecond fasteners second fasteners 224 can be formed with an insert slot, and each of thefirst fasteners 219 can be formed with an inverted L-shaped hook for engaging the insert slot of a corresponding one of thesecond fasteners 224. - In summary, by virtue of the
215, 219 of thefirst fasteners frame member 21 and the 223, 224 of thesecond fasteners fabric enclosure member 22, thefabric enclosure member 22 can be assembled to theframe member 21 without the use of screws, thereby shortening the assembly time and improving the durability of theplaypen 2 of this invention. - While the present invention has been described in connection with what are considered the most practical and preferred embodiments, it is understood that this invention is not limited to the disclosed embodiments but is intended to cover various arrangements included within the spirit and scope of the broadest interpretation so as to encompass all such modifications and equivalent arrangements.
